What is B0BB5?
The B0BB5 diagnostic trouble code (DTC) pertains to a malfunction in the Electric Power Steering (EPS) system of a vehicle. This code is particularly common in models like the 2016-2020 Toyota Camry and Honda Accord, where the EPS system is critical for providing steering assistance. When the EPS system encounters a fault, it can lead to increased steering effort and potentially unsafe driving conditions. The EPS system relies on sensors to monitor steering input and vehicle speed, adjusting the level of assistance accordingly. If these sensors fail or if there’s an issue in the power steering control module, the B0BB5 code may be triggered. Drivers may notice symptoms such as difficulty steering, a warning light on the dashboard, or strange noises from the steering column. Ignoring this issue can lead to further complications, including complete loss of steering assistance, making it essential to address the code promptly. Symptoms
Common symptoms when B0BB5 is present:
- Check engine light or EPS warning light stays illuminated on the dashboard, indicating a system fault.
- Steering feels unusually heavy or stiff during low-speed maneuvers, making it hard to turn the wheel.
- Unusual noises, such as whining or grinding, can be heard when turning the steering wheel, suggesting a mechanical issue.
- Increased steering effort, particularly when parking or navigating tight spaces, which can lead to driver fatigue.
- Random loss of steering assistance while driving, which can be dangerous and requires prompt diagnosis.
Possible Causes
Most common causes of B0BB5 (ordered by frequency):
- Faulty EPS control module - approximately 40% likelihood, often due to electrical faults or software issues.
- Malfunctioning steering angle sensor - around 30% likelihood, which can disrupt the system's ability to gauge steering input accurately.
- Damaged wiring or connectors - about 20% likelihood, where exposure to moisture or wear can cause shorts or disconnections in the system.
- Low power steering fluid level - 5% likelihood, as insufficient fluid can lead to pump failure and system malfunctions.
- Rarely, a failure in the power steering pump itself may occur, particularly in older models, leading to significant steering issues.
